Staying Near Eugene V Debs Museum: 4 Family Hotels Compared

The Eugene V. Debs Museum sits in a quiet residential pocket of Terre Haute's west side, on North Eighth Street - a neighborhood that trades urban buzz for genuine calm. Families visiting the museum typically combine it with Indiana State University's campus, the Children's Science and Technology Museum, and Fairbanks Park along the Wabash River. Hotels in this area cluster around the university corridor and major commercial strips like South Third Street and Margaret Avenue, placing guests within a short drive of the museum without requiring a downtown commitment.

What It's Like Staying Near Eugene V Debs Museum

The area around the Eugene V. Debs Museum is a low-traffic, walkable residential district in west Terre Haute - not a tourist-dense zone. The museum itself is inside the historic Debs home on North Eighth Street, surrounded by quiet tree-lined blocks. Most hotels are within a 5-minute drive, not walking distance, so families will need a car or rideshare for daily access. The benefit is that the surrounding hotel corridors along Margaret Avenue and Third Street offer much lower noise levels than city-center alternatives, and free parking is standard across all properties near this area.

Smart Travel & Timing Advice

Terre Haute's peak hotel demand clusters around Indiana State University's academic calendar - fall move-in weekends, homecoming, and graduation periods in May drive occupancy up sharply. Visiting the Eugene V. Debs Museum between late September and early November gives families pleasant temperatures, lower hotel rates than summer peak, and lighter crowds at nearby attractions like Turkey Run State Park. Summer rates (June-August) are elevated due to university camp programs and regional tourism, but the Debs Museum itself remains uncrowded year-round. A single overnight stay is logistically sufficient for the museum visit plus one or two supporting attractions, but families combining Turkey Run State Park may benefit from a second night to avoid rushing. Book at least 3 weeks ahead for any weekend stay during the academic year. Last-minute availability improves significantly on weekdays outside the university calendar, often with rates closer to the lower end of the nightly average for this corridor.
